Transaction 128b9e76447c58b492e175e3f28093b19c476f693207c66e1c6075daee19398a

1 Input
1 Outputs
  • 128b9e76447c58b492e175e3f28093b19c476f693207c66e1c6075daee19398a:0
  • value  542920
    address  3PhW5HawjyQvSQoZPBncvfHD7F5YHuKatE